Tumbler Laser Engraving Machine
This one-stop solution is designed specifically for the branding and customization of tumblers and cylindrical products. Inside this expansive, purpose-built workcell, these key technologies converge: lasers, optics, and robotics with integrated machine vision.
The Tumbler Laser Engraving Machine employs a CO2 laser to ablate paint on the surface of a tumbler based on preset parameters, creating a permanent pattern. CO2 laser marking is a non-contact method for removing coating without damaging the metal surface of the tumbler. Employing the thermal impact of high-energy light, this technique conserves resources and promotes sustainability in industrial marking operations.
The result – whether it’s a centered company logo, valuable product data, or a custom design encircling the tumbler – is exceptional in quality, contrast, and uniformity.
Intuitive Programming, Smooth Integration
The synchronization of these advanced technologies is achieved through a fully integrated distributed control system, coordinated by CMS Laser’s proprietary software. The CMS Process Engine, a Windows-based HMI, orchestrates the control system and provides a simple operator interface for selecting and running jobs. It also provides a password-protected, fully featured machine programming interface.
Artwork setup is performed using CMS LaserGraf5, which sets the graphics position and assigns laser parameters. Source artwork is generated in familiar third-party tools like Adobe Illustrator or Inkscape, which produce Scalable Vector Graphic (SVG) files. Once the SVG is created, the CMS software handles the details.
For initial system setup, our team pre-programs several tumblers you manufacture to ensure accurate robot grip and seamless graphics alignment. We will train your personnel to set up additional tumbler variations. The Tumbler Laser Engraving Machine handles tumblers up to 120 mm in diameter. If this standard size is too small, CMS’s in-house engineering staff can design a machine to your exact specifications.
During processing, the tumbler lineup can be entered manually or via a barcode scanner for ease of data entry. Each tumbler is placed in a multi-size puck and moved into and out of the workcell via a conveyor. Inside, the robotic arm handles the rest, transporting the tumbler to and from the marking station, as well as rotating it for precise positioning using the smart vision system.
Integrating two laser marking stations that function concurrently, the system perfectly complements high-volume production environments. The entire process of running two tumblers through the system and getting them on the other side perfectly marked takes about 2 minutes, depending on the complexity and size of the graphics.
If your production line is fully automated, the Tumbler Laser Engraving Machine can be seamlessly adapted to operate unattended as a lights-out system.
Robotic Automation

Robotic automation accelerates industrial processes, helping increase efficiency, improve quality and consistency, and reduce labor costs. At CMS Laser, we leverage proven, advanced technologies from renowned suppliers. In this use case, the Tumbler Laser Engraving Machine integrates a FANUC 4-axis SCARA pick-and-place robot with a 6 kg payload capacity. This robot ensures high-speed transport and precise placement as it works in-sync with the integrated smart machine vision camera for accurate alignment of the marking area. The convergence of these technologies guarantees uniform, repeatable results for the final product.
Safety-First Engineering
The Tumbler Laser Engraving Machine features a fully enclosed, interlocked workcell for laser processing. The system is rated Class I according to CDRH laser safety standards, meaning no hazardous radiation escapes the enclosure during operation. Personnel need no protective gear and can safely observe the process through laser-safe windows. Should the procedure require an immediate halt, emergency stop buttons are located within reach of the main operating points.
The workcell’s fume extraction system effectively filters out vaporized particles released during the marking process. Whether ablating acrylic paint, enamel paint, powder coating, or epoxy, the particles are trapped by the filter. This prevents their buildup on the equipment and release into the air, ensuring cleaner operations and minimized maintenance. Aside from the fume extractor filters, minimal consumables are required for the system’s operation. This leads to low maintenance costs and increased production uptime.
